Alamo Hospice is a hospice care center situated at San Antonio, Texas. This palliative care is medicare certified, hence if you are covered by medicare, medicare will pay the hospice for your care. Alamo Hospice accommodated approx. 558 Medicare beneficiaries whose average age was 82 years in CY2016. Unique hospice identification number provided by medicare to this hospice care is 671540. Alamo Hospice comes under the CMS regional office located at Dallas. This CMS regional office covers all hospices located in Arkansas, Louisiana, New Mexico, Oklahoma, Texas. Services provided at Alamo Hospice mainly includes home health aide, counseling, medical social services, medical supply services, nursing services, occupational therapy, physician services, physical therapy, short term inpatient care, speech pathology services.
Alamo Hospice provides special care for people who are terminally ill. This involves a team-oriented approach that addresses the medical, physical, social, emotional, and spiritual needs of the patient. Hospice also provides support to the patient’s family or caregiver.

Average Service Hours per Day

Alamo Hospice provided an average of 0.22 hours per day of home health, 0.14 hours per day of Skilled Nursing, 0.03 hours per day of Social Service hospice care.

Average Hospice Care Days

Alamo Hospice have 42 Medicare beneficiaries with 7 or fewer hospice care days, 309 Medicare beneficiaries with more than 60 hospice care days, 153 Medicare beneficiaries with more than 180 hospice care days.


Beneficiaries by Gender


Alamo Hospice rendered hospice services to 231 Male and 327 Female Medicare beneficiaries in a calendar year.

Beneficiaries by Race


Alamo Hospice provided hospice care to 281 White, 24 Black, 241 Hispanic, Other 12 not disclosed Medicare beneficiaries in a calendar year.

Medicare/Medicaid Eligible Beneficiaries


At Alamo Hospice, 336 beneficiaries enrolled in Medicare Advantage and 126 beneficiaries were eligible for Medicaid for at least one month of hospice care in the calendar year.


Beneficiaries with Primary Disease Diagnosis

At Alamo Hospice, distinct Medicare beneficiaries who received hospice care for a primary diagnosis are 96 of Cancer, 143 of Dementia, 42 of Stroke, 163 of Heart Disease, 42 of Respiratory 72 of Other Diseases

Site-of-service Hospice Beneficiaries

At Alamo Hospice, distinct Medicare beneficiaries who received the majority of their hospice care days are 384 at home, 66 in an assisted living facility, 104 in a long term care or non-skilled nursing facility,
